Bill Text: NY S06467 | 2021-2022 | General Assembly | Introduced


Bill Title: Modifies what constitutes obstruction to a driver's view or driving mechanism; provides that the hanging of air fresheners and other devices from the rearview mirror is explicitly permitted.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 2-0)

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2022-01-05 - REFERRED TO TRANSPORTATION [S06467 Detail]

        AN ACT to amend the vehicle and traffic law, in  relation  to  modifying
          what constitutes obstruction to a driver's view or driving mechanism

          The  People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:

     1    Section 1. Section 1213 of the vehicle and traffic law, as amended  by
     2  chapter 621 of the laws of 1963, is amended to read as follows:
     3    § 1213. Obstruction  to  driver's  view  or  driving mechanism. (a) No
     4  person shall drive a motor vehicle when it is so loaded, or  when  there
     5  are  in  the  front  seat  such  number  of  persons as to substantially
     6  obstruct the view of the driver to the front or sides of the vehicle  or
     7  as to substantially interfere with the driver's control over the driving
     8  mechanism  of  the  vehicle.  In no event shall there be more than three
     9  persons in the front seat of any vehicle, except  where  such  seat  has
    10  been  constructed  to  accommodate  more than three persons and there is
    11  eighteen inches of seating capacity for each passenger  or  occupant  in
    12  said front seat.
    13    (b)  No  passenger  in  a  vehicle shall ride in such a position as to
    14  substantially interfere with the driver's view ahead or to the sides, or
    15  to substantially interfere with his or  her  control  over  the  driving
    16  mechanism of the vehicle.
    17    (c)  Notwithstanding  any  other provision of law to the contrary, the
    18  hanging of air fresheners and other devices from the rearview mirror  is
    19  explicitly  permitted  and shall not provide a basis for a traffic stop,
    20  fine, fee or any penalty whatsoever.
    21    § 2. This act shall take effect immediately.


         E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ets
                              [ ] is old law to be omitted.
